The Hidden Dangers Of Roof Leaks: Why Prompt Repair Is Essential

Roof leaks are typically dismissed as minor inconveniences, but if left unaddressed, they can lead to significant structural damage, health hazards, and financial burdens. A leaky roof situation is a symptom of underlying issues that can compromise a home’s safety and integrity.

Understanding the hidden dangers of roof leaks and the importance of timely repairs is crucial for homeowners who want to protect their investment and ensure the well-being of their families. Read on to learn why prompt repair of roof leaks is essential.

Structural Damage

One of the most immediate and severe consequences of a roof leak is structural damage. Water intrusion can weaken the framework of a home, including the rafters, joists, and walls. Over a matter of time, this moisture can cause wood to rot, original metal roof to corrode, and insulation to deteriorate. In extreme cases, prolonged exposure to water can compromise the structural integrity of the entire building, leading to sagging ceilings, warped floors, and even collapse.

Also, the damage is gradual, making it difficult to detect until it becomes a major problem. For instance, water seeping into the attic can saturate the roof insulation, reducing its effectiveness and increasing energy costs. Additionally, moisture trapped in walls or ceilings can lead to the growth of mold and mildew, further exacerbating the damage.

Health Hazards

Roof leaks can create a damp environment ideal for mold and mildew growth. Mold spores can spread quickly, contaminating the air and posing serious health risks to occupants. Exposure to mold can also trigger allergies, respiratory issues, and even more severe conditions such as asthma or bronchitis. Individuals with weakened immune systems, such as children, the elderly, or those with chronic illnesses, are particularly vulnerable.

Moreover, the presence of mold can degrade indoor air quality, leading to unpleasant odors and a generally unhealthy living environment. Removing mold can be a complex and expensive, often requiring professional remediation. Electrical Hazards

Water and electricity are a dangerous combination. Roof leaks can allow water to seep into electrical systems, creating a significant fire hazard. Water can damage wiring, outlets, and electrical panels, increasing the risk of short circuits, power outages, or even electrical fires. In some cases, water intrusion can cause appliances and electronics to malfunction, leading to costly replacements.

Homeowners should also be particularly cautious if they notice water stains near light fixtures, outlets, or switches, as this is a noticeable sign of potential electrical issues. Financial Consequences

Ignoring a roof leak can lead to substantial financial consequences. What starts as a minor issue can quickly escalate into a major problem, requiring an extensive professional roof repair or even a full roof replacement. The longer a leak is left unaddressed, the more damage it can cause, driving up repair costs.

In addition to the direct costs of repairing the residential roof, homeowners may also face higher energy bills due to compromised insulation, expenses related to mold remediation, and potential increases in insurance premiums. Decreased Property Value

A leaky roof can significantly reduce a property’s value. Potential buyers will likely be deterred by visible signs of water damage, mold, or structural issues. Even if the roof damage isn’t immediately apparent, a history of roof leaks can raise red flags during a home inspection, leading to lower offers or difficulty selling the property.

Furthermore, maintaining a well-functioning roof is essential for preserving a home’s value. Regular inspections and prompt repairs can ensure the roof remains in good condition, protecting the homeowner’s investment and making the property more attractive to potential buyers.
